尤其
yóuqí
Meaning
尤其 is an adverb meaning “especially”, “particularly”. It highlights the most notable part of a wider situation.
Basic structure
General statement,尤其 + the highlighted item
Examples
您女儿真可爱,长得真像您,尤其是眼睛。
Your daughter is lovely and really looks like you — especially her eyes.
现在网上购物变得越来越流行了,年轻人尤其喜欢在网上买东西。
Nowadays, online shopping is becoming increasingly popular, and young people especially love buying things online.
为了健康,我们应该每年都去医院做一次身体检查,尤其是那些四五十岁的人。
For our health we should have a check-up every year — especially those in their forties and fifties.
尤其 vs. 特别
我喜欢水果,尤其是苹果。
I like fruit, especially apples.
今天特别冷。
It's especially cold today.
尤其 → singles out one item within a group.
特别 → emphasises a high degree.
特别是 → the same as 尤其是, more colloquial.
